Salary & Relocation Package
Below is a mobile-friendly breakdown of salaries and benefits:
| Job Role | Average Salary (CAD/year) | Experience Level | Relocation Package | Sponsorship Availability |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Construction Project Manager | $90,000 – $140,000 | Mid/Senior | Yes | High |
| Senior Project Manager | $110,000 – $160,000 | Senior | Yes | High |
| Project Coordinator | $65,000 – $95,000 | Entry/Mid | Sometimes | Medium |
| Site Manager | $80,000 – $120,000 | Mid-Level | Yes | High |

Visa Types for Construction Project Managers
1. Temporary Foreign Worker Program (TFWP)
- Requires LMIA approval
- Employer-sponsored work permit
2. Global Talent Stream (GTS)
- Fast-track visa (2–4 weeks)
- Ideal for highly skilled professionals
3. Express Entry (Federal Skilled Worker Program)
- Points-based PR pathway
- Suitable for managers
4. Provincial Nominee Program (PNP)
- Provinces nominate high-demand professionals
- Faster PR options

Permanent Residence (PR) Pathways
| PR Program | Processing Time | Benefits |
|---|---|---|
| Express Entry (FSW) | 6–8 months | Fast PR |
| Provincial Nominee Program | 6–12 months | Easier eligibility |
| Canadian Experience Class | 12 months | For workers in Canada |
